To start, just pick a unique random counter filename (ending with .dat) following UNIX naming rules (such as mywebsite-0002010.dat - it must be different from all other users' names) to identify your counter. Then simply call the counter (replace my-counter.dat with the name you picked) with:
<IMG SRC="https://freecounter.theraphit.com/scripts/Count.cgi?df=my-counter.dat">
And that's it! No further steps required!! Using this call will automatically create the counter and should then display something like this:

You may create as many counters as you want by changing the .dat filename in the URL. Any non-existent counter will be automatically created, and existing ones will be incremented. Just make sure the filename you choose is unique!

Want to start the counter with a higher value? Add st=value to the CGI query string. For instance:
<IMG SRC="https://freecounter.theraphit.com/scripts/Count.cgi?st=500000&df=my-counter.dat">
You don't need to change this line after counter initialization, as the st parameter is ignored when calling an existing counter.
